MySQL DOS安装命令失效解决方案

mysql dos安装命令不能用

时间:2025-06-26 18:49


MySQL DOS安装命令无法使用?这里有解决方案! 在使用MySQL进行数据库管理时,有时我们可能会遇到在DOS(Disk Operating System,磁盘操作系统)环境下MySQL命令无法使用的情况

    这不仅影响了我们的工作效率,还可能阻碍项目的顺利进行

    本文将深入探讨MySQL DOS安装命令无法使用的可能原因,并提供一系列切实有效的解决方案,帮助您迅速恢复MySQL命令的正常使用

     一、可能的原因分析 1.MySQL未正确安装: - 这是最常见的原因之一

    如果MySQL没有正确安装,或者安装过程中出现了错误,那么DOS环境下自然无法使用MySQL命令

     2.环境变量未配置: - MySQL的可执行文件路径需要添加到系统的环境变量中,才能在任何目录下通过DOS命令提示符执行MySQL命令

    如果未配置环境变量,系统将无法找到MySQL的可执行文件

     3.权限问题: - 当前用户可能没有足够的权限来执行MySQL命令

    在Windows系统中,这通常意味着需要以管理员身份运行命令提示符

     4.命令拼写或参数错误: - 输入的MySQL命令可能存在拼写错误,或者参数格式不正确,导致命令无法执行

     5.MySQL服务未启动: - MySQL服务是执行MySQL命令的基础

    如果MySQL服务未启动,那么任何MySQL命令都将无法执行

     6.版本兼容性: -使用的MySQL命令可能与当前安装的MySQL版本不兼容

    这通常发生在升级MySQL版本后,旧版本的命令在新版本中不再有效

     7.网络问题: - 如果MySQL服务器不在本地,可能存在网络连接问题,导致无法执行MySQL命令

     二、解决方案 针对上述可能的原因,我们可以采取以下解决方案来恢复MySQL DOS命令的正常使用

     1.确认MySQL是否已正确安装: - 打开DOS命令提示符,输入`mysql --version`查看是否能显示MySQL的版本信息

    如果没有显示版本信息,说明MySQL可能未正确安装或未配置环境变量

     - 如果MySQL未安装,可以从MySQL官方网站下载并安装适合你操作系统的版本

    安装过程中请确保遵循所有提示和默认设置,以避免安装错误

     2.配置环境变量: - 如果MySQL已安装但命令仍不可用,需要将MySQL的安装路径添加到系统的环境变量中

     - 在Windows系统中,可以通过右击“此电脑”选择“属性”,然后点击“高级系统设置”进入“系统属性”窗口

    在“环境变量”部分找到“Path”变量并编辑,添加MySQL的bin目录路径(例如:`C:Program FilesMySQLMySQL Server8.0bin`)

     - 在Linux和macOS系统中,可以通过修改`~/.bash_profile`或`~/.zshrc`文件来添加环境变量

    添加`export PATH=$PATH:/usr/local/mysql/bin`(请根据你的MySQL安装路径进行调整)并重新加载文件(使用`source ~/.bash_profile`或`source ~/.zshrc`命令)

     3.以管理员权限运行: - 在Windows系统中,右击“开始”菜单选择“Windows PowerShell(管理员)”或“命令提示符(管理员)”来以管理员身份运行DOS命令提示符

     - 在Linux和macOS系统中,通常不需要特别以管理员身份运行终端,但确保你有足够的权限来执行MySQL命令

     4.检查命令拼写和参数: -仔细检查输入的MySQL命令是否存在拼写错误或参数格式不正确的问题

    例如,启动MySQL服务的命令应该是`net start mysql`

     5.启动MySQL服务: - 如果MySQL服务未启动,可以使用`net start mysql`命令来启动服务

    在启动服务之前,可以使用`sc query mysql`命令来检查MySQL服务的状态

     6.检查版本兼容性: - 如果你最近升级了MySQL版本,请确保你使用的命令与当前安装的MySQL版本兼容

    可以参考MySQL的官方文档或社区论坛来获取关于版本兼容性的信息

     7.检查网络连接: - 如果MySQL服务器不在本地,请确保你的计算机可以访问该服务器

    可以使用`ping`命令来测试网络连接

     三、实际操作步骤 以下是一个具体的示例,展示如何在Windows系统中通过DOS命令提示符安装并配置MySQL,以及解决MySQL命令无法使用的问题

     1.下载并解压MySQL压缩包: - 从MySQL官方网站下载适合你操作系统的MySQL压缩包并解压到一个目录(例如:`D:MySQLmysql-8.0.xx`)

     2.配置环境变量: -右击“此电脑”选择“属性”,然后点击“高级系统设置”进入“系统属性”窗口

    在“环境变量”部分找到“Path”变量并编辑,添加MySQL的bin目录路径(例如:`D:MySQLmysql-8.0.xxbin`)

     3.安装MySQL服务: - 以管理员身份运行DOS命令提示符,进入MySQL的bin目录(例如:`D:MySQLmysql-8.0.xxbin`),输入`mysqld install`命令来安装MySQL服务

     4.初始化MySQL数据目录: - 在bin目录下输入`mysqld --initialize`命令来初始化MySQL的数据目录

    这将在MySQL的安装目录下创建一个data文件夹,并生成必要的系统表

     5.启动MySQL服务: - 输入`net start mysql`命令来启动MySQL服务

    如果服务启动成功,你将能够在DOS命令提示符下使用MySQL命令

     6.验证MySQL命令是否可用: - 输入`mysql --version`命令来检查MySQL的版本信息,确认MySQL命令已经可用

     四、总结 MySQL DOS安装命令无法使用的问题可能由多种原因引起,包括未正确安装MySQL、未配置环境变量、权限问题、命令拼写或参数错误、MySQL服务未启动、版本兼容性以及网络问题等

    通过仔细检查并采取相应的解决方案,我们可以迅速恢复MySQL命令的正常使用

    本文提供的解决方案不仅适用于Windows系统,也部分适用于Linux和macOS系统(需要注意环境变量配置和命令的细微差别)

    希望这篇文章能帮助您解决MySQL DOS命令无法使用的问题,提高您的工作效率